The Rise of Expanded Mesh Facades in Modern Architecture
In the world of contemporary architecture, expanded mesh facades have gained significant attention for their unique combination of functionality and aesthetic appeal. This innovative building material, characterized by a network of interconnected metal strips, serves as both a protective barrier and an artistic element, allowing for creative designs that enhance both residential and commercial properties.

One of the most significant advantages of using expanded mesh facades is their versatility. Available in various materials such as aluminum, stainless steel, and carbon steel, these facades can be adapted to different climates and architectural styles. The ability to customize the size, shape, and pattern of the mesh allows for limitless design possibilities, pushing the boundaries of what is possible in architectural expression.
Energy efficiency is another crucial factor driving the popularity of expanded mesh facades. In today’s environmentally conscious society, many architects and builders aim to optimize energy consumption in their designs. Expanded mesh facades can contribute to thermal regulation in buildings, reducing the need for artificial heating and cooling. Their ability to allow natural light while minimizing glare also creates a comfortable indoor environment, lowering dependency on electrical lighting during the day.
Moreover, expanded mesh facades contribute to the overall sustainability of buildings. By using durable materials that require less maintenance over time, these facades can significantly reduce long-term upkeep costs. The modular nature of expanded mesh systems allows for ease of installation and replacement, promoting a more sustainable approach to construction and renovation.
The aesthetic aspect of expanded mesh facades cannot be overlooked. Architects are increasingly drawn to the striking visual impact these facades can create. Whether used as a primary exterior finish or as a decorative element, the interplay of light and shadow created by the mesh patterns adds depth and character to buildings. By reflecting the surrounding environment, expanded mesh facades can enhance the overall architectural landscape, creating a seamless integration between structure and nature.
